Intermittent fasting, in essence, involves alternating periods of eating and fasting. The most common methods include the 16/8 method, where individuals fast for 16 hours and eat during an 8-hour window, and the 5:2 diet, where individuals eat normally for five days and restrict their calorie intake to 25% of their normal intake for the other two days. The rationale behind intermittent fasting is that it mimics the natural eating patterns of our ancestors, promoting metabolic health and potentially aiding in weight loss.

On one hand, intermittent fasting may have a positive impact on muscle growth. During the fasting period, the body enters a state of ketosis, where it begins to use fat as its primary energy source. This can lead to increased fat loss, which in turn can help to reveal muscle definition. Additionally, some research suggests that intermittent fasting can improve insulin sensitivity, which is crucial for muscle growth and recovery.

Moreover, the fasting period can also trigger the release of human growth hormone (HGH), which plays a significant role in muscle growth and repair. Studies have shown that HGH levels can increase by up to 5-fold during fasting, potentially promoting muscle growth and recovery.

On the other hand, there are concerns that intermittent fasting may negatively affect muscle growth. During the fasting period, the body may enter a state of catabolism, where it starts breaking down muscle tissue for energy. This can be particularly detrimental for individuals who are actively trying to build muscle, as it may lead to muscle loss and a decrease in strength.

To mitigate the risk of muscle loss, it is essential to consume an adequate amount of protein during the eating window. Protein is crucial for muscle repair and growth, and consuming it in sufficient quantities can help to preserve muscle mass during intermittent fasting. Additionally, timing protein intake strategically can also help to minimize muscle breakdown. For instance, consuming a high-protein meal or snack immediately after a workout can support muscle recovery and growth.

In conclusion, the impact of intermittent fasting on muscle growth is a complex topic with both potential benefits and drawbacks. While intermittent fasting may promote fat loss, improve insulin sensitivity, and increase HGH levels, it can also lead to muscle breakdown if not managed properly. To maximize the benefits of intermittent fasting while minimizing the risks to muscle growth, it is essential to consume an adequate amount of protein, time protein intake strategically, and engage in regular resistance training.
